The difference between these ... The condition can be mistaken for an infection, an ingrown hair or other conditions. Many people live with undiagnosed hidradenitis suppurativa for years before receiving a correct diagnosis. Your doctor will base a diagnosis on your signs and symptoms, skin appearance and medical history.
